Three verified-open defects, one family: sync silently destroying or
diverging on content it should preserve.
#2404 (P0) — 'ops' was hardcoded in PRUNE_DIR_NAMES (a v0.2.0-era
carve-out), so any path with an ops segment was 'pruned-dir': committed
ops/*.md never imported, and modified ops/* files hit the
unsyncableModified delete loop (whose #1433 guard only spared
'metafile'), silently deleting put-created pages like the bundled
daily-task-manager's canonical ops/tasks on every sync. Fix: remove
'ops' from the prune list (ordinary user content; the vendor/generated
entries stay), and harden the delete loop to also skip 'pruned-dir' —
a page under a pruned dir can only exist via a deliberate put_page.
#2426 (P0) — write-through content stayed DB-only and was deleted by
sync --full. All three compounding bugs fixed:
1. writePageThrough now best-effort commits the artifact (path-limited
git commit) on durability-hardened repos, so the post-commit hook
can push it; result carries committed?: boolean.
2. scripts/brain-commit-push.sh stages+commits BEFORE any pull — the
old fetch+pull-rebase-first order aborted on any dirty tree, so the
helper could never commit a MODIFIED page; brain_push's
rebase-on-reject already handles an advanced remote.
3. The full-sync delete-reconcile partitions stale pages by git
history (listEverCommittedPaths): never-committed source_paths are
DB-only write-through — pages are KEPT and re-exported to the
working tree instead of soft-deleted. Builds on the #2828
mass-delete valve (covers the below-valve cases).
#2607 — the sync --full git ls-files fast path bypassed pruneDir, so a
full pass imported (and resurrected soft-deleted) pages under dot-dirs
and vendored trees that incremental sync excludes. Fix:
isCollectibleForWalker applies the same segment-level pruneDir gate as
classifySync, so full and incremental enumeration agree.
One regression test per defect (all verified failing against master
src): test/sync-ops-pages.serial.test.ts,
test/write-through-commit.serial.test.ts, the #2426 helper-order test
in test/brain-durability-hook.serial.test.ts,
test/sync-reconcile-db-only.serial.test.ts,
test/import-git-fastpath-prune.test.ts.
